Understanding and Relieving Leg Cramps

Leg cramps can be an uncomfortable and painful experience, often disrupting daily life and sleep. These involuntary muscle contractions typically affect the calf muscles but can occur in other parts of the legs as well. While leg cramps can happen to anyone, they are more common in older adults and athletes. Understanding the causes and various methods for relief can be the first step towards managing this condition effectively.

There are several potential causes of leg cramps that one should consider. Dehydration, overexertion, and deficiencies in essential minerals like potassium, magnesium, or calcium are common triggers. Furthermore, prolonged sitting or standing in one position can also lead to muscle cramps. Identifying personal triggers is crucial in preventing frequent occurrences of leg cramps. Addressing these factors can significantly reduce the risk and frequency of cramps.

Once the cause of leg cramps is identified, several effective remedies can be implemented. Stretching exercises before bedtime, staying hydrated, and maintaining a balanced diet rich in essential nutrients are some solutions. Applying heat or cold to the affected muscles can also provide immediate relief. In chronic cases, consulting with a healthcare provider for personalized treatment is recommended to ensure a comprehensive approach in dealing with leg cramps.
